OHM Advisors is seeking a motivated and experienced Project Engineer in Airport projects to join our Transportation growing team! As a community-focused firm with a singular mission of Advancing Communities, you'll play a key role in designing and managing critical infrastructure projects at airports.

The successful candidate will be responsible for leading engineering and design efforts for construction plan sets including specifications in accordance with FAA standards and procedures.

Your Primary Focus

  • Provide civil engineering expertise for various airport improvement projects, including runways, taxiways, terminals, and other airfield elements.
  • Collaborate with architects, planners, and other engineers to develop cost-effective and constructible designs.
  • Participate in the collection and analysis of data for the preparation of satisfactory airport designs.
  • Perform drainage analysis, pavement design, quantity estimates, QA/QC and other airfield-specific engineering tasks.
  • Organize scheduling of specific assigned tasks and assignments.
  • Provide aid in the development of project scope and budgets.
  • Oversee construction activities to ensure compliance with plans and specifications, addressing RFI's during construction and attend construction progress meetings as required.
  • Anticipate project issues, including advising the client on alternatives and providing recommendations for solving issues.
  • Stay up-to-date on the latest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) regulations and design standards.
What you'll need to succeed
  • Bachelor's Degree in Civil Engineering
  • Minimum of 5 years' experience in airport civil engineering design and construction.
  • Proven experience with AutoCAD, Civil 3D, and other relevant engineering software.
  • Excellent understanding of FAA Advisory Circulars and standards.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Effective commun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Process or an ability to obtain Michigan PE License.
  • Desire and ability to maintain strong client relationships.
  • Good organizational skills and enjoy working in a team environment.
